According to the established tradition, Russian schoolchildren have a rest four times a year.

The question of the timing of the holidays for students is decided by the School Council individually in each educational institution. Usually the decision is made at the very beginning of the school year and is enshrined in the order of the school director. At the same time, there are terms recommended annually by the Ministry of Education and Science of the Russian Federation, as well as by district and district departments in charge of education. These guidelines are optional, but most schools try to take them into account when preparing work plans for the year. As a rule, the beginning of the holidays is tied to the beginning of the school week. In autumn, this is the first Monday in November (the duration of the rest is 7-10 days); in winter, the holidays start on the last Monday in December and last 14-20 days. Spring school breaks lasting 7-10 days are usually scheduled for the last Monday in March. The longest vacations are summer ones, usually starting on May 24 or 25 and lasting until the end of August. Since there are no uniform legislative norms setting the dates and dates for vacations in Russia, the administration of each educational institution draws up a schedule of students' rest independently. At the same time, it should be noted that if the school is private, the dates of the beginning of the holidays may differ significantly from the holidays in public schools. As stated in the Law of the Russian Federation “On Education, students must unlearn during the year as long as the basic plan of educational activities provides. The law does not say about the exact dates of the holidays. Currently, the curriculum provides 36 academic weeks, while the remaining 16 weeks of the year are allocated for vacation. It is the responsibility of school administrators to allocate this time. However, parental committees may require the school to change the timing of vacations and distribute the school workload differently, making it more convenient for students and parents, and not just for teachers. Usually, the class schedule is adjusted to the teaching staff. In some schools, the dates of the holidays are also planned taking into account the wishes of the school authorities.
